Double glazing is one of the most popular house improvement techniques, however there are scary stories of bad fittings, loud vents and even long-term damage to the house. Before choosing a double glazing business, consider the following factors: Look for a double glazing company that has actually been in business for a number of years the longer, the better.
Client reviews made up the bulk of our research study. It is necessary to check out all client reviews and testimonials, on third-party sites, prior to deciding. The company's action to unfavorable reviews need to also factor into the decision. Constantly guarantee that the double glazing company is FENSA-registered and certified with constructing policies.
Double glazed windows are harder to break than single glazed windows, providing extra security and security along with advanced locking systems. Water vapour constructs up in the air and surfaces on your glass, which can lead to undesirable dampness and mould in your house. Double glazed windows reduce condensation and avoid the build-up of water vapour.
Whether they use long-lasting guarantees, a reduced carbon footprint, low rates and value for money, or versatile payment terms, you can examine your options to find the best double glazier for your job. Double glazing refers to windows that include two panes of glass, separated by a layer of gas.
Double glazing lasts about 20-35 years, depending on the quality of the materials and the workmanship, however some experts think it can last approximately 40 years or longer. In numerous instances, double glazing can minimize noise, such as on busy highways or rail lines, drastically. It does depend upon the material used, however.

Casement windows are connected to the frame with several hinges, normally permitting them to open to the side.
They normally open inwards, which generally makes them much easier for cleaning. They are held open by 'sash stays' small metal bars that open and close in a scissor motion. Casement windows are typically u, PVC, but can likewise be made of wood and aluminum check out on listed below for more details about window products.
